Mark asked our opinion on Emerge Energy Services (ticker:EMES).  These MLP units now trade around $15–down from a 52 week high of $133–wow.  One of their businesses is frack sand–among other oil field services. I took a quick look at last quarters earnings announcement and it is surprising how well they have performed (not the stock of course). They have a current yield of 17% and my guess is that it will drop from here, but even if it fell 50% from here it would still yield 8.5%. Our guess is shares will fall further, but if we were younger we might consider starting to scale in here–maybe a 100 shares here and see what happens. No doubt shares will trade with the price of oil and there is likely some more pain to be endured in the oil patch.
